Of course it's a UFO. That doesn't mean it's aliens. Just means you don't know what it is and it appears to be flying.

To my knowledge, the only planet you can see during daylight (and only on rare occasions) is Venus.

If you're certain that it wasn't more windshield debris, then it could be anything. Could have been an aircraft flying directly towards you or directly away from you so it only appeared to be stationary. Could have been just a very slow, moving object (like a blimp). Since the picture isn't clean, there's really no way of identifying it.
